Question on Invisible Glass/Ammonia

I live Stoner's I/G alot, but does it contain Ammonia or not?
Sure smells like it does. The debate has been that Ammonia
is bad for tinted windows - does this mean factory or A/M tint
or both?

Cleaning glass is harder than the outside I think!
Definitely use towels, not paper towels.

Ammonia is bad for aftermarket tint, the kind they stick to the inside of the window. The OEM tint is within the glass.
